I had GD with DD - diagnosed at about 30 weeks, fully diet controlled (and by all accounts a 'mild' case).
Had no issues post birth with either DD or myself.
6 week post-pg GTT test came back all clear.
Now Im pg with #2 and wondering the likelihood of developing GD again - anyone get GD with first but not with subsequent pgs?

I had it with #1 and like you controlled it with diet. 6 week PP test came back normal.
With #2 i developed GD and was put on insulin around 15 weeks, again the 6 week PP test came back fine.
